Today is World Bee Day 🐝🐝
Bees role as one of the worlds major pollinators means they play a vital role in crop yields, ensuring food security, sustainable agriculture and biodiversity.

"A new study shows the behaviour and reproduction of ground-nesting bees, like those that pollinate squash and pumpkins, is severely impacted when farmers treat the soil with neonicotinoid insecticide at the time of planting."
